Abstract:
The present invention is regarding plants and plant storage organs thereof in which GLP-1 derivatives are accumulated, and methods of producing them. The transgenic plants and plant storage organs thereof accumulate tandem repeated GLP-1 derivatives cleavable with intestinal digestive enzyme to monomeric molecules and are produced by methods comprising: integrating into vectors linked DNAs which comprise tandem repeated DNAs encoding the GLP-1 derivative with trypsin resistance in which the amino acid in the 26th position is Gln, the amino acid in the 34th position is Asn or Asp, and C-terminal consists of Arg or Lys to produce monomeric molecules; introducing the vectors into plant cells; and redifferentiating the obtained transformants. The edible transgenic plants and plant storage organs are useful for treating diabetes and can be ingested by diabetic patients.
